Seems like disabling USB when 1.5G is plugged in works, but then I loose my working USB which I use for my working memory stick and floppy drive. Enabling and disableing ACPI had no effect. When I enable usb, dmesg is the same up to the point of hanging with the exception of the mem and iomem fields in the "atapci0" and "atapci1" lines. With 1.5G and usb enabled, my hung kernel says: atapci0: ...mem 0x80207600 - 0x802077ff... the port locations are the same atapci1: ...mem 0x80207400 - 0x802075ff... the port locations are the same Attached are full dmesg outputs of configurations that work, i.e. no hang: "dmesg_0.5G" - 0.5G memory, full usb, full ACPI (6.3 .iso kernel) "dmesg_1.0G" - 1.0G memory, full usb, full ACPI (6.3 .iso kernel) "dmesg_1.5G_nousb" - 1.5G memory, no usb, full ACPI (6.3 .iso kernel) I also tried 6.2 .iso kernel from the install CD and it still hangs with 1.5G. I do not know how I can provide you with a full dmesg when the system hangs. Can you tell me how I can log output of a boot sequence that hangs for later analysis? I have no shells in which to run dmesg.
